diff --git a/src/types.jl b/src/types.jl index 06f4daf..e3eb0ac 100644 --- a/src/types.jl +++ b/src/types.jl @@ -674,7 +674,7 @@ function init_neuron!(id::Int64, n::linearNeuron, n_params::Dict, kfnParams::Dic subscription_options = shuffle!([kfnParams[:totalInputPort]+1 : kfnParams[:totalNeurons]...]) subscription_numbers = Int(floor((n_params[:synapticConnectionPercent] / 100.0) * - kfnParams[:totalNeurons])) + kfnParams[:totalNeurons] - kfnParams[:totalInputPort])) n.subscriptionList = [pop!(subscription_options) for i = 1:subscription_numbers] n.synapticStrength = rand(-5:0.01:-4, length(n.subscriptionList))